Coloring Tips for Kids
Tree Trunk and Branches
- Use earthy tones like browns (#8B4513) and dark reds (#A0522D) to bring the tree to life.
Treehouse
- Consider warm colors for the wooden planks, like honey brown (#DAA520) or a light wood shade (#DEB887).
Roof
- A classic red (#FF0000) or green (#228B22) can make the roof stand out and feel vibrant.
Birds
- Color the birds with soft blues (#87CEEB) or yellows (#FFD700) to make them pop against the roof.
Ladder
- Mimic the treehouse with similar wood tones, or choose a contrasting color like a cool gray (#A9A9A9).
Slide
- Apply bright, fun colors like a bold blue (#1E90FF) or a cheerful yellow (#FFFF00) to highlight its playful aspect.
Leaves and Tree Canopy
- Classic green shades (#32CD32) are perfect for depicting a lush and lively environment.
Encourage children to explore their creativity, blending these colors to bring this architectural illustration to life.
